(资料图)
Apple刚刚发布的 M2 Ultra是一款强大的处理器,具有 24 个通用内核和多达 76 个集成 GPU 内核。它也可能比 2019 年 Mac Pro 中的英特尔 28 核 Xeon W 更快,因此新的Mac Pro工作站用户将感受到显着的性能提升。但根据据最新的基准测试(来自@VadimYuryev),这款 CPU 无法在Geekbench 5中击败来自 AMD 和英特尔的竞争对手,因为这些对手拥有非常高的运行频率或具有强大的核心数量。
重型工作站级处理器不同于台式机和服务器 CPU,因为它们应提供非常灵敏的性能(与所有客户端处理器一样)和在繁重工作负载下始终如一的高性能。这意味着它们必须具有更高的每时钟指令性能(IPC)、高时钟频率、高内核数、支持内存负载以及 PCIe 通道负载。AMD的Ryzen Threadripper Pro(线程撕裂者)W5995X和英特尔的Xeon W9-3495X分别通过其64和56内核符合这些要求。简而言之,他们使用配置为在需要时提供极高时钟的服务器芯片。
谈到 Apple 的 M2 Ultra,它由两个主要为 MacBook Pro 和 Mac Studio机器设计的 M2 Max 片上系统组成。这些工作站功耗适中,不支持扩展性。M2 Max 并不是为高时钟或可扩展性而设计的,因为您只能在紧凑型 PC 中安装这么多的内存和存储。当出现计算繁重的工作负载时,M2 不会将时钟提升到极限,而是使用内置的专用加速器。由于电源和冷却限制,它也不是为极端核心数而设计的。虽然两个 M2 Max 在纸面上看起来很强大,但它们不能拥有英特尔酷睿 i9-13900K 的高时钟频率或 AMD 的 Ryzen Threadripper Pro W5995WX 的核心数量。
这就是为什么基准测试结果显示苹果的M2 Ultra在单线程工作负载上无法击败英特尔的酷睿i9-13900K,甚至在Geekbench 5的多核工作负载测试中落后。英特尔的台式机产品支持同时多线程(simultaneous multi-threading),可以立即处理多达 32 个线程。与其实际竞争对手AMD的Ryzen Threadripper Pro W5995X和英特尔的Xeon W9-3495X相比,M2 Ultra在单线程工作负载中轻松击败了它们,但在需要更多内核时速度要慢得多。有些人可能会争辩说,Geekbench 5是一个综合基准测试,不能反映实际应用程序中的性能,这是一个公平的论点。但它可以了解 CPU 在没有任何专用加速器的情况下对其计算能力的期望。这让我们想到了一个事实,即苹果的M2 SoC内部有很多加速器。因此,它可能不需要具有高时钟或极端内核数即可在许多工作站级工作负载中提供出色的性能。话又说回来,凭借强大的计算能力,AMD 和 Intel 的工作站处理器旨在处理最苛刻的工作负载。也就是说,Apple 的 Mac Pro 能否在工作站应用中真正击败基于 AMD 和英特尔 CPU 的工作站还有待观察。